Use Short Phrases
You can say tsuuyaku wa arimasu ka, eigo de soudan dekimasu ka, or yasashii nihongo de onegaishimasu.
Show the Document
If the problem is a letter or form, show it and say kore ga wakarimasen or kakikata wo oshiete kudasai.
Say Your Language
Say your language name clearly, for example eigo, betonamugo, chuugokugo, or tagarogugo.
For Phone Calls
Prepare your name, address, phone number, and what you want to ask before calling.
Important Procedures
For immigration, medical, legal, tax, or school matters, confirm carefully because translation mistakes can cause problems.
